Boats at Sutton Wharf, 1976
Boats at Sutton Wharf, 1976
On the left an ordinary 40 ft pleasure narrow boat, on the right an intriguing little boat, the Ashby Canal Association trip boat 'Ace', built as a miniature narrow boat. For a better view of this, see SP4199 : Ashby Canal Association trip boat 'Ace', 1976.
